(New Tecumseth, ON) – On the 5th of September 2014, shortly after 4:00 p.m. officers from the Nottawasaga OPP as well as Emergency Personnel responded to reports that a 12 year old boy was injured; after being struck by a motor vehicle on John W Taylor Avenue in the Town of New Tecumseth. .
It was learned that a school bus with the cross lights activated was off loading students at that time, including the injured 12 year old boy. The boy had exited the bus, and proceeded towards the back of the bus, to cross the road. When the boy began to cross the road the cross lights were deactivated on the bus and a motor vehicle travelling in the opposite direction collided with the boy. No charges were laid.
The 12 year old boy sustained minor head injuries and was transported to the hospital by ambulance, where he was later released to his parents.
The OPP are reminding motorists that when travelling on all roadways to be extra vigilant and cautious during the hours when students are getting on or off the school bus and/or walking to or from school.
Drivers are reminded that….
– when approaching or following a School Bus they are required to Stop when the overhead red signal-lights are flashing and the stop arm is extended.
· continue to scan your surrounding area upon departing a school bus that has just off-loaded students.
· no vehicles can resume travel until the red signal-lights have stopped flashing, the stop arm is retracted and the bus starts moving;
· slow down in a Community Safety Zone. Fine amounts are doubled for speeding in a Community Safety Zone.
The set fine for disobeying this law amounts to $490 and 6 demerit points.
